Administrative and related classifications

The ACT Public Service Administrative and Related Classifications Enterprise Agreement 2021-2022 is approved by the Fair Work Commission and came into effect from December 2021.

The agreement covers the following classifications:

  • Administrative Service Officer
  • Audit Office Band 1
  • Audit Office Band 2
  • Cadet (administrative)
  • Capital Linen Service (clerical staff)
  • CTEC Manager
  • Dental Receptionist
  • Graduate Administrative Assistant
  • Housing Manager
  • Housing Manager Trainee
  • Indigenous Trainee
  • Principal Research Officer
  • Research Officer
  • School Assistant
  • Senior Officer
  • Senior Research Officer
  • Teacher
  • Tourism and Events Officer
  • Trainee (administrative)
  • Trust Officer

Health professionals

The ACT Public Sector Health Professionals Enterprise Agreement 2021-2022 is approved by the Fair Work Commission and came into effect from February 2022.

The agreement covers the following classifications:

  • Chief Medical Physics
  • Dentist
  • Health Professional
  • Medical Physics Registrar
  • Medical Physics Specialist
  • Principal Medical Physics Specialist
  • Radiation Therapist
  • Senior Medical Physics Specialist

Infrastructure services

The ACTPS Infrastructure Services Enterprise Agreement 2021-2022 (ISEA) is approved by the Fair Work Commission and came into effect from January 2022.

The agreement covers the following classifications:

  • Administrative Service Officers (employed as City Rangers in TAMS)
  • Apprentice (excluding HSO apprentices)
  • Building Service Officer
  • Capital Linen Service (production staff, maintenance staff, drivers)
  • Facilities Service Officer
  • General Service Officer
  • Ranger
  • Senior Stores Supervisor
  • Sportsground Ranger
  • Stores Supervisor

Medical practitioners

The ACT Public Sector Medical Practitioners Enterprise Agreement 2021 - 2022 is approved by the Fair Work Commission and came into effect from January 2022.

Nursing and midwifery

The ACT Public Sector Nursing and Midwifery Enterprise Agreement 2020-2022 covers all Registered Nurses, Enrolled Nurses and Assistants in Nursing, is approved by the Fair Work Commission and came into effect from January 2022.

Support services

The Support Services Enterprise Agreement 2023-2026 is approved by the Fair Work Commission, came into effect from December 2021 and covers:

  • Administrative Service Officer (employed as Youth Workers in CSD)
  • Allied Health Assistant
  • Apprentice (HSO)
  • Clinical Coder
  • Clinical Coder Trainee
  • Dental Assistant
  • Disability Support Officer
  • Health Service Officer
  • Principal Dental Assistant
  • Rehabilitation Teacher

Technical and other professionals

The ACTPS Technical and Other Professional Enterprise Agreement 2023-2026 (TOPEA) is approved by the Fair Work Commission, came into effect from January 2022 and covers:

  • Cadet (information technology and professional)
  • Facilities Technical Officer
  • Hospital Technical Services Officer (Calvary)
  • Information Technology Officer
  • Office of Regulatory Services Inspector
  • Park Ranger
  • Professional Officer
  • Public Affairs Officer
  • Senior Information Technology Officer
  • Senior Officer Technical
  • Senior Park Ranger
  • Senior Professional Officer
  • Senior Professional Officer (Engineering)
  • Senior Public Affairs Officer
  • Sterilising Services Health Service Officer
  • Sterilising Services Technical Officer
  • Technical Officer
  • Trainee Information Technology Officer
  • Trainee Technical Officer
  • Veterinary Officer
